Unlike with several other cancer cells types, individuals diagnosed with a tiny papillary thyroid growth have time to understand their treatment alternatives and get a 2nd viewpoint, she included."With thyroid cancer, commonly, choosing concerning treatment isn't immediate, "said Dr. Haymart."It's completely great for people to take some time to process the info, consider their choices, talk with relative and loved ones, and create a decision that's right for them, she claimed. Davies."It's not an emergency situation."Some people might be able select a surveillance technique, having a small thyroid blemish imaged routinely and not acting unless it begins to grow, clarified Dr. Haymart. Others may intend to have a needle biopsy and choose based upon those outcomes. And molecular tests are ending up being readily available that can help identify whether a little thyroid mass is basically likely to consist of cancer cells. Such examinations can aid establish whether surgical procedure is needed. These show that there is an extremely tiny excess risk of cancer cells from treatment with contaminated iodine. For most patients the benefit of treating the overactive thyroid gland far outweighs the incredibly reduced cancer cells threat. Radioactive iodine treatment is not offered to: Pregnant women -radioiodine goes across the placenta and can influence the thyroid gland creating in the expected infant


A Biased View of Thyroid Specialist


Breast-feeding ladies- the radioactive iodine passes using the milk to the infant's thyroid gland Anybody that is regularly throwing up or incontinent People with energetic thyroid eye disease as it might intensify the eye illness unless steroids are given at the same time If the thyroid gland is extremely overactive, radioactive iodine can create dangerously high degrees of thyroid hormone and, really rarely, a problem referred to as thyroid crisis or tornado. In some cases the thyroid gland is a little bit tender after treatment. This will normally clear after a couple of days. An usual longer term side-effect of contaminated iodine therapy is an underactive thyroid gland (hypothyroidism ), so it is very essential to have regular thyroid blood examinations beginning from four to 6 weeks after the treatment to determine and treat this early, with levothyroxine. There is no threat that patients treated with contaminated iodine for an overactive or bigger thyroid will shed their hair
as a result of the therapy (Thyroid Specialist). You will be look at these guys suggested radioactive iodine by a physician that is licensed to do so. Your treatment will certainly occur in a health center but you do not require to be confessed to healthcare facility as an inpatient. The dosage is taken either as an easy capsule ingested with mouthfuls of water, or as a beverage. The gland needs to be working when this treatment is taken, so antithyroid tablets
must be quit typically at the very least one week before the therapy is offered and not considered at the very least one week later on. You may additionally be asked to make use of beta-blockers to ease any kind of short-lived signs and symptoms of hyperthyroidism. Your doctor will go over with you prior to therapy whether you must reboot the medicine later on and when. After therapy, and depending upon the quantity
of daily get in touch with you have with others, you might be asked to avoid call with other individuals momentarily. As check my site a general guideline you must maintain arm's length for two to 3 weeks, yet the size of time relies on the dosage utilized and individuals you will certainly touch with.


If you are travelling within this time period you need to carry a letter from your healthcare facility explaining the treatment you have actually had. The amount of radioactive iodine made use of to regulate an overactive thyroid gland can be provided without challenging arrangements, as long as you are not working with contaminated materials or on treatments that would be upset by the radioactivity.
